### Ticket: Tide-table widget config drift — security review needed

Hey — the Moonpull tide-table widget on the Saltgrass portal is pulling predictions from a different endpoint in prod than what's in version control. Somebody hand-edited the live config months back and it never got committed, so we've got drift plus an unreviewed data source. Before we reconcile, security should sanity-check both configs for anything sketchy. Here's what the live widget is actually running with right now.

settings of yageg-yahap:
[gorael]
team = olieth
access_code = ac_941d74
owner = brieth.aldiel
host = gorael.tolvaqio.internal
port = 6379
peer = briwyn.urlaqtech.internal
salt = 116e6622
pin = 1957

## Further Reading

The Givenly receipt mailer exposes hooks before and after each donation receipt is rendered, letting plugins inject custom footers or alternate tax language. Plugins must not modify the receipt total or the issuing-charity block. Template variables, hook signatures, and versioning rules are maintained on our internal reference page.

operations page: https://jenkins.zemvarcloud.local/job/merge_requests/repo/build/73930b4b30f0a8ed

**Q: My plugin's build artifacts are rejected with "timestamp out of range" — why?**

A: The Forgemont build farm tolerates at most 90 seconds of clock skew between agents. If your plugin signs artifacts locally before upload, a drifted agent clock can invalidate the signature window. Check the agent's sync status in the dashboard before rebuilding. Should you need to reset a quarantined agent's trust store, supply the recovery passphrase given below.

unlock words, yawig-kagef: gordor-holvan-ulaael-pramir-ulaiel-tamdor

Step 4: Configure the digest scheduler. The Fernwick batch emailer reads its cron window from the staging env file; keep the window between 02:00 and 04:00 to avoid colliding with the Ostler import job. Before enabling the scheduler, set the mail relay credential on the line immediately following this step.

vault entry, yahif-yajep: COURIER_KEY29=b802bdf8034096b65a51c6ba5abe2